What Is an Industrial Panel PC?

An industrial panel PC is an integrated computing system that combines a touchscreen display with a rugged industrial-grade computer. These systems are commonly used in:

Factory automation

Machine control interfaces

Industrial IoT applications

Logistics and warehousing

Medical and food production environments

Unlike consumer-grade PCs, industrial panel PCs are designed to withstand dust, moisture, vibration, extreme temperatures, and 24/7 operation.

Preventive Maintenance Tips

Proactive maintenance helps avoid failures and ensures consistent performance. Here are key maintenance practices:

1. Regular Cleaning

Exterior: Use a soft, anti-static cloth to wipe dust off the screen and housing.

Vents and Fans: Dust accumulation can lead to overheating. Clean air vents and internal fans using compressed air periodically.

Touchscreen Surface: Use screen-safe cleaning solutions to maintain clarity and responsiveness.

2. Monitor Temperature and Humidity

Industrial panel PCs often run in environments with temperature fluctuations. Make sure:

The ambient temperature stays within the system's specified range.

There is adequate airflow in the installation area.

Use panel PCs with fanless or IP-rated designs for challenging environments.

3. Inspect and Secure Cables

Loose or damaged cables can cause intermittent power or data loss. Periodically:

Check power and Ethernet cables for wear.

Ensure connectors are secure and free from corrosion.

Replace aging cables to avoid signal degradation.

4. Update Firmware and Software

Keep the system’s BIOS, OS, drivers, and industrial application software up to date to:

Improve stability and performance

Address security vulnerabilities

Enhance compatibility with new peripherals

Troubleshooting Common Issues

Even the most robust systems can experience hiccups. Here are some common issues and how to resolve them:

1. System Not Powering On

Check power input and power supply unit.

Inspect connectors for loose or damaged pins.

Test with a known good power source.

2. Unresponsive Touchscreen

Clean the screen surface thoroughly.

Recalibrate the touchscreen via the control panel or driver software.

Update or reinstall the touchscreen driver.

3. Overheating or Automatic Shutdowns

Verify fan operation and check for blocked ventilation.

Ensure the system isn’t exposed to excessive ambient heat.

Consider adding heat sinks or repositioning the unit for better airflow.

4. Display Issues (flickering, no signal, distorted colors)

Check for loose VGA/HDMI connectors.

Test with an external monitor.

Update GPU or chipset drivers.

5. Peripheral Malfunctions (e.g., keyboard, scanner)

Test the peripheral on another machine.

Try a different USB port or update the port drivers.

Check system logs for hardware conflicts.
